**Alert: Migration guard tripped — Corvid Schema Runner**

This alert fires when a zero-downtime migration on the Pelham cluster holds a lock longer than the safe window, pausing subsequent steps automatically. Customer traffic is not interrupted; writes queue briefly. Support should expect a small latency bump, no data loss. Do not advise customers to retry bulk imports until the alert clears. Step-by-step status checks are on the internal page here.

runbook for badug-kadup: https://confluence.zemvarlabs.internal/projects/browse/display/projects/bd1b

**FAQ: ShrinkRay CLI locked out of its credential store — what now?**

Applies to ShrinkRay v3+, the batch image-resize CLI from Pellwood Tools. If a customer reports "credential store sealed" after repeated auth failures, this is expected behavior. Do not advise reinstalling; the store persists. Confirm the customer is on the licensed tier, then walk them through `shrinkray unlock` from the install directory. The command prompts once; pasting with trailing whitespace fails silently, so warn them. Have them enter the recovery passphrase below.

vault phrase of taweg-kafof = oliax-zorael

- [ ] Step 7: Archive cold storage buckets (Glacierline tier). Confirm both ceremony witnesses are present, verify bucket manifests match the Oxbow ledger, then seal the archive key shares. Plugin authors may observe but not handle shares. Once sealed, the archive index itself is encrypted and can only be reopened with the passphrase below.

vault phrase of badup-hahig = tamael-aldael-kelmir-istael-fenok-istwyn-tamius-jorath-oliion